Examples of "Clean" Hip-Hop Songs (over 30 years) (from Adam Kruse)

The following comes from Adam Kruse's (2016) article, "Featherless Dinosaurs and the Hip-Hop Simulacrum: Reconsidering Hip-Hop's Appropriateness for the Music Classroom" in Music Educators Journal.

​Examples of “Clean” Hip-Hop Songs (over 30 years)
“Clean” is in the ears of the listener. Teachers should listen ahead before using these in class. Many of the artists listed below have numerous “clean” songs.

1986 – “It’s Tricky” by Run-DMC
1987 – “I Know You Got Soul” by Eric B. and Rakim
1988 – “Lyte as a Rock” by MC Lyte
1989 – “You Must Learn” by Boogie Down Productions
1990 – “Can I Kick It?” by A Tribe Called Quest
1991 – “Summertime” by DJ Jazzy Jeff & The Fresh Prince
1992 – “Jump” by Kris Kross
1993 – “Keep Ya Head Up” by 2Pac
1994 – “We Run Things (It’s Like Dat)” by Da Bush Babees
1995 – “I Wish” by Skee-Lo
1996 – “Earth People” by Dr. Octagon
1997 – “Just Cruisin’” by Will Smith
1998 – “Everything is Everything” by Lauryn Hill
1999 – “Hip Hop” by Mos Def (Yasiin Bey)
2000 – “When Kenpo Strikes” by RedCloud
2001 – “Held Down” by De La Soul featuring Cee-Lo
2002 – “It’s Going Down” by Blackalicious
2003 – “I Can” by Nas
2004 – “Breathe, Stretch, Shake” by Ma$e featuring P. Diddy
2005 – “Birds Eye View” by Zion I
2006 – “Kick, Push” by Lupe Fiasco
2007 – “Paper Planes” by M.I.A.
2008 – “Lip Gloss” by Lil Mama
2009 – “Creepin’” by Chamillionaire featuring Ludacris
2010 – “Window Seat” by Erykah Badu    
2011 – “Beautiful” by Talib Kweli featuring Big K.R.I.T., Outasight & Mela Machinko
2012 – “Good Feeling” by Flo Rida
2013 – “I’m Turnt” by Lecrae
2014 – “Glory” by Common & John Legend
2015 – “Sunday Candy” by Donnie Trumpet & The Social Experiment
